A Deep Dedication to Art

The truth is, he didn't just dabble; he took a considerable amount of time off from his acting career to focus on his art. He spent a year and a half, believe it or not, dedicated to creating these works. This isn't just a hobby, then; it's a serious artistic endeavor that required real sacrifice of his usual profession, which is, obviously, a big deal for someone of his standing.

This kind of dedication, where someone steps away from their main successful career, really shows how much he values this other side of his creative expression. It suggests that, for him, painting is not merely a fleeting interest but a profound need to communicate through different means. You know, it's a pretty strong statement about his passion.

Influences and Personal Inspirations

When it comes to what fuels his art, Adrien Brody draws from some very personal places. His work, in some respects, channels the lively, sometimes chaotic, energy of his younger years. This raw energy, you see, seems to be a key ingredient in the visual language he employs in his pieces.

Beyond his own experiences, the empathy of his mother, Sylvia Plachy, a renowned photographer, also plays a role. It's clear that her artistic sensibility and compassionate outlook have, apparently, shaped his perspective, lending a certain depth to his creations. This connection to his family's artistic background is, arguably, a very strong foundation for his own unique style.

He's spoken about how these influences combine, forming a sort of emotional and historical backdrop for his paintings. It's not just about putting paint on a surface; it's about conveying feeling and personal history, which, you know, makes the art feel more connected to him as a person.

So, What's the Fuss All About?

To say that film star Adrien Brody's art divides art world commentators is, honestly, quite an understatement. Some have described it as "horrendous," while others find it compelling or, at the very least, interesting. This range of reactions, you know, is pretty wide, making it a very talked-about subject.

The pieces often feature a kind of raw, almost visceral quality. He's been seen, for instance, kneeling on a drop cloth, smearing and swirling paint with a plastic card until it forms patterns. This hands-on, almost primal approach to creation, might be part of what makes the work so polarizing. It's not, you know, always about precision, but about expression.

The aesthetic is, in a way, quite different from what one might expect from a classically trained artist, which, apparently, contributes to the strong opinions. It pushes boundaries for some, while others might feel it doesn't quite meet traditional artistic standards. It's a bit like a conversation starter, if nothing else.

Pop Culture Icons and Unconventional Displays

His recent art exhibition, which is, you know, his first in nearly a decade, has quickly become a talking point, especially for its inclusion of famous figures. You might see pop culture icons like Marilyn Monroe or Mickey Mouse in his pieces, which adds a very recognizable element to his often abstract or expressive style.

Then there's the presentation, which is, arguably, just as much a part of the art as the paintings themselves. The exhibition features, quite notably, a "gum wall." This unconventional element, in a way, challenges traditional gallery displays and adds another layer of intrigue to the experience. It's, so, very much about the overall impression, not just the individual artworks.

These choices, like incorporating widely known figures or using unusual display methods, tend to make the art more accessible to some, while others might see it as, you know, a bit of a gimmick. It certainly ensures that the art is not easily forgotten, and that's, perhaps, part of the point.
